Watch Aljazeera’s Documentary On Abducted Katsina Students
International media, Aljazeera, has done a documentary on the abducted students of Government Science secondary school, Kankara, Kastina State.
The headline to the story on Aljazeera’s website reads: Hundreds of pupils feared abducted after an attack on Nigeria school”.
And they also have a documentary on the abduction. The media house spoke to a relation of one of those abducted and the woman who was visibly angry said they have not felt the impact of the Government in their community.
Recall on Friday bandits had stormed the Government Science secondary school in Kankara district and abducted some students. The State Governor puts the number at 333, saying that number of students remains missing.
